Biography
British singer, guitarist and founder of the 1970's British punk band,the Buzzcocks. Although he recorded a solo album in 1974 it wasn't released until 1979, three years after he joined the Buzzcocks. The group disbanded in 1981 and Shelley flew solo again. He rejoined the Buzzcocks in 1988 after a short stint with another group.
